Barack Obama's new catch phrase which has somehow been made into a song, of course by the Black Eyed Peas (featuring numerous other celebrities), cause they're SO politically conscious. The song is meant to be inspiring, yes people working together, we'll change the world, etcetera, etcetera, except it really leaves me wondering whether william or whatever his fucking name is (I know there are some fucking periods somewhere in it) has any ear for music, because the song sounds like crap, and the Obama voiceover kills any possibility of a person actually enjoying the experience of listening to it, because (and I'm not naming any names) certain types of peas just can't make music.
In spanish yes we can translates as si se puede, but the song still sucks orangutan tits.
by Cloudwacher22 February 5, 2008
Get the yes we can mug.